No, not affected: Pregnancy and delivery does not usually cause periods to become irregular. It may be more than a month after delivery before a woman starts having menstrual periods, especially if she is breastfeeding. Breastfeeding may cause irregular periods, but otherwise once her periods start again, the menstrual cycle is usually similar or the same as it was prior to pregnancy.
